Monsters [2010]
I liked this movie but the advertising and posters for it is misleading. It makes you think it’s about a monster outbreak or rampage with frenetic “move-or-die” plot, but it’s not. It’s kind of like a serious “road trip” movie that just happens to be in the context of “there are some alien monsters somewhere”.
To put it into a slightly more understandable comparison, it’s like if A.I. Artificial Intelligence was marketed as Terminator or if Eternal Sunshine of the Spotless Mind was marketed as Inception. It’s a bit logical in the way that it may (misleadingly) get people into the theater and hopefully they enjoy the curve ball but even if you’re pleasantly surprised, you still feel slightly cheated.
